论坛
门户
内部优惠
喜欢
话题
VIP会员
搜索
新浪微博
登录
注册
100%
100%
首页
>
网络技术
>
网络技术
>
如何在hanlp词典中手动添加未登录词
回复
« 返回列表
hadoop小学生
精灵王
注册日期
2018-09-13
发帖数
160
QQ
3234520070
火币
360枚
粉丝
0
关注
0
加关注
写私信
打招呼
阅读:
3467
回复:
0
如何在hanlp词典中手动添加未登录词
楼主
#
更多
只看楼主
倒序阅读
发布于:2019-03-18 15:10
保存
100%
100%
[]
1
我们在使用
hanlp
词典进行
分词
的时候,难免会出现分词不准确的情况,原因是由于内置词典中并没有收录当前的这个词,也就是我们所说的未登录词,只要把这个词加入到内置词典中就可以解决类似问题,如何操作,下面我们就看一下具体的步骤
1
、
找到
hanlp内置词典目录
位于
D:\hnlp\hanlp_code\hanlp\data\dictionary\custom也就是Hanlp安装包中的data\dictionary\custom下目录
图片:图1.png
2
、
将未登录词以词名,词性,词频的格式添加到文件中(句首或者句尾都可以)
图片:图2.png
3
、
将字典的同名
bin文件删除掉
执行文件时读取的是
bin文件,必须删掉后等下次执行时重新生成,新字典才发挥作用
图片:图3.png
4
、
使用新字典重新执行文件
执行时会遇到没有相关
bin文件的提示,不过放心,程序会自动生成一个新的bin文件,骚等片刻,就好了。
图片:图4.png
验证结果是否正确
图片:图5.png
喜欢
0
评分
0
最新喜欢:
DKHadoop用着还不错!
回复
100%
发帖
回复
« 返回列表
普通帖
您需要登录后才可以回帖,
登录
或者
注册
100%
返回顶部
关闭
最新喜欢